Awareness Regarding Intraoral Scanners Among Dental Students

Abstract
Introduction: Intraoral scanners (IOS) are equipment used in dentistry to capture direct optical impressions. They project a light source onto the object to be scanned, such as dental curves, including aligned teeth and implants, just as standard three-dimensional (3D) scanners.Although IOS are becoming widespread in clinical dental practice, only a few are aware of the advantages and limitations of the intra oral scanners.The aim of the study was to assess the awareness of intra oral scanners among undergraduates of dental school.
AIM: The aim of the study was to assess the awareness of intra oral scanners among undergraduates of dental school.
OBJECTIVE: To Evaluate awareness regarding Intraoral Scanners among Dental Students.
METHODS: This was a cross-sectional survey done among the age group of 18-27 years to analyse knowledge, attitude and practice on intraoral scanners among undergraduate students. A self administered questionnaire was prepared which included 14 questions and was circulated among the students. The data was collected and statistically analysed using spss software. The survey was conducted among 200 study populations
